Water can start wars, but it can also be a bridge to peace. And as a Middle East environment news blog, Green Prophet thinks “green” solutions – be it water, clean energy, clean air – can stimulate and lubricate peace. That’s why we engaged in a series of interviews with Israeli water experts in partnership with the Strategic Foresight Group. There’s been a lot of talk about how Israel manages its water, but what solutions do its experts, policy makers and business people see as viable for water security in the Middle East?
We launched into a deep investigation and found the influentials in the country’s water industry. (Scroll down for the complete list of interviews.) Today’s interview with the desk of the Ministry of Environmental Protection. We hope that loyal readers finds this series useful, and that policy makers, and journalists will have new channels of experts to approach.
The former businessman is working to solutions for peace and cooperation with the nearby Gaza City. He thinks through water is a good way to achieve that. Here are his views on the water situation in Israel and regional water cooperation:
Q. Turkey and Israel have had talks about freshwater supply and purchase in the past. The Turkish government has been positive in its overall response so far but there is some opposition to this in the Turkish political spectrum. If the Turkish government were to agree to supply 1 BCM of freshwater to Israel, is there a possibility that Israel will agree in return to share this water with the Palestinian Authority (PA) and Jordan?
A1. This project that you mention between Turkey and Israel is not economical and therefore is not relevant.
Q2. Israel is counting on desalination as a major source of its future water supply. However, there are limits to the growth of Israel’s water supply based on marginal water alone. What are the other ‘regional’ solutions that Israel can examine in terms of water cooperation with other countries?
A2. Water shortage is a common problem amongst all countries in the Middle East. One of the regional solutions that Israel should consider is transportation of water. They have extra water in Lebanon. Perhaps we should consider transportation of water from Lebanon for all the countries in the region where there is shortage of water.
Q3. Lebanon’s Litani River has a particularly high quality of water, with a very low quantity of chlorates and nitrates present. Water cooperation with Lebanon would therefore serve Israeli interests but in order for this to happen, political cooperation between these two parties is required; in addition Israel-Lebanon relations are inter-linked with the Israel-Palestine conflict. Is it worth it for Israel to find political cooperation with Lebanon in order to secure its water situation or is this not a practical option?
A3. Israel wants peace with all the countries of the region and this could result in a very positive initiative. One of the outcomes of such peace would be cooperation on water. Water can be a cause for war but it can also be a good platform for peace.
Q4. Technical reports suggest that over-pumping is leading to the depletion of groundwater aquifers in the West Bank, both in terms of water levels as well as water quality. This could cause water shortages in the short-run and devastation of the eco-system in the long-run. What can be done to preserve these aquifers?
A4. Desalination is a part of the solution. Both the Israelis and the Palestinians are pumping water; the state of Israel supplies 40 -50 million cubic meters of water every year to the Palestinians. The best solution is for cooperation is the regional management of water.
Q5. Israel has experienced a severe drought period in the recent past. With environmental neglect and the effects of climate change, this can be a frequent and imminent risk in the future. What can be done to minimize the impact of such a danger in terms of national measures as well as well as regional cooperation?
A5. At the national level Israel has implemented the use of re-used water for agriculture. Israel should also utilize and manage a more effective water system. At the regional level Israel can assist and share its experience with others in the region. Another promising effort in regional cooperation is the pilot project that is being implemented in Gaza using sewage water for agriculture.

China takes a shine to Israel and invests more than $10 million in new solar technology innovation.
Israel’s solar tech company HelioFocus, based on research from the Weizmann Institute, will be invested in by China’s Zhejiang Sanhua 002050 in a $10.5 million agreement, reports HelioFocus in a press announcement. The solar thermal systems developed HelioFocus will be the first direct investment made by a Chinese company in an Israeli one, reports Tova Cohen from Reuters.
The Chinese company will not only be a developer but a strategic partner, and is expected to produce components and control parts to enable the technology.
It can harness 20 times more energy than any other wave technology in existence today and also produce carbon-free desalinated water. How? Seanergy ‘holds the waves.’
To wean America off polluting and politically unstable foreign oil, government members and legislators are advocating technologies such as solar, wind, geothermal and also wave energy to develop new sources of power. President Obama is pushing for green jobs and Americans want them.
Inspired by children playing with a beach ball at the seaside, Shlomo Gilboa an Israeli politician-turned-inventor has invested millions of his own dollars in Seanergy, a new company and product that share a name. Seanergy harvests the energy of ocean waves through an offshore farm of buoys. It could be the next technology adopted by American utility companies, if Gilboa has his way.
In an interview with me, Gilboa relates that the technology now being tested off the coast of Haifa can harness 20 times more power from wave energy than any other similar technology in existence today.
“Our harvesting system from the sea produces at least 20 times more energy than conventional or non-conventional buoys,” says Gilboa, who is also the company’s CEO. “In our system, we manage to ‘hold the wave’. Usually it’s come and gone in a second. But we manipulate it, holding the wave level in a reservoir in the buoy, to capture it.”
Popping up in a burst of power
The buoy literally shoots up when it reaches the crest of the wave: “With the same impact as when you take a ball and put it underwater in the swimming pool and it pops up in a huge burst of energy,” explains Gilboa. “We are harvesting this special energy. No other system in the world comes close.”
Seanergy is currently working with the Israel Electric Corporation and has been endorsed by engineers at the University of Haifa. As of 2022 it looks like the company is out of business.
Seanergy buoys at the port of Haifa. As of 2022 it looks like this company is no longer active.
Gilboa says that while generating electric power, the system also produces a significant amount of carbon-free desalinated water. He estimates that a million cubic meters of desalinated water will be produced by a Seanergy farm that covers a 300 square meter (about 3,229 square foot) patch of water at sea. While traditional desalination plants can produce orders of magnitudes more water, unlike Seanergy they require an extensive amount of energy input to the system.
Currently a number of large and small companies around the world are negotiating with the company about a first facility, which will require a $2 million investment for four, four-buoy clusters. Gilboa says that according to the most conservative projection, the Seanergy buoy system, which sits below the surface of the waves and pops up as it collects energy, can pay for itself in feed-in tariffs within three years.
Making waves
To illustrate his point, Gilboa describes the Seanergy cluster in a region off the coast of Oregon in the US. Each buoy there can generate 1 megawatt of power, which over a year amounts to 200 to 250 kilowatts per cluster. According to the Cnet tech journal, that’s enough to power about 80 homes. The amount generated at any given site is a function of the wave action potential there.
Companies all over the world are attempting to capture the power of waves and there are a plethora of what appear to be zoologically-inspired prototypes that range from the bizarre to the sublime.
There are massive ‘snakes’ (655-foot-long anaconda devices), ‘oysters’ (large hydraulic flaps that open and close) and ‘dragons’ (contraptions with long arm-like devices that direct waves up a ramp toward an offshore reservoir). The weird-looking snakes move hypnotically through the waves.
Of these, Gilboa credits potential competitors such as the Scottish-based Pelamis and New Jersey’s Ocean Power Technologies as two wave technology companies that “add real value to the market.”
15 years of development
Seanergy presented its prototype at the “Innovation” pavilion in the Industry, Trade and Labor Ministry’s NEWTech division for the estimated 19,000 people who attended the international Watec conference in Tel Aviv in November. NEWTech promotes Israeli water technologies worldwide.
Although the company was officially formed in 2008, the idea has been in development for about 15 years, and millions of dollars of personal financing were invested in the prototype. Based in Haifa, Seanergy employs a small staff of four, but has worked with more than 100 consultants and specialists to get its prototype to ‘float.’
At the Haifa National Museum of Science Seanergy is presented as an important and radical new green technology. In the near future, you may see its buoys bouncing around a coast near you.

Copying the wildly popular Cash for Clunkers program in the United States, the Israeli government has announced its own plan to get polluting gas guzzlers off the streets and cities of Israel.
While it’s not really that common to see Texas-size Cadillacs and old gas guzzling V8 engines in Israel anyway – with gas at about $2 USD a liter, and with 100% import tax, who could afford such luxuries – the plan is to get people to trade in their more polluting hunks of steel for more fuel efficient, less polluting cars.
The troubled history of the Susita, the short-lived Israeli-made car reflects the conflict between Israel’s attraction to Western technology and the Middle-Eastern corruption that often hobbles advances in the Middle East.
The first car-composting lot opened in the city of Ashdod on Friday and new sites are expected to open across the country over the coming months. The deal is that anyone with a car more than 20 years old (you must have proof) will be given NIS 3,000 (about $800 USD) in exchange.
Some NIS 100 million (about $30 million dollars) has been allocated to support the program, being sponsored by Israel’s ministries of environmental protection and infrastructure. The Hebrew reporter writing the article did say that the Israeli version of Cash for Clunkers was copied on the model developed by US President Barack Obama.
An ad for Susita in 3 models, a car that camels liked to eat
The American program, whose name has been changed to the rather less catchy Car Allowance Rebate System, proved enormously popular. Owners received $4,500 each for their heaps of steel. More than 700,000 new vehicles were sold as part of the program, which a number of other countries have also adopted (Mexico too, for example).
Thousands of polluting cars, which are also deemed unsafe, are expected to be taken off the roads. Perhaps to pave the way for Shai Agassi’s electric car of Better Place?
A water conference in Jordan was a call to arms in Arab world to fight water insecurity. Photo: Water tanks on the roofs of buildings in Madaba, Jordan.
There are people in over 17 Arab countries living well below the water poverty line of 500 cubic metres annually, said Arab decision makers from around the Arab world, meeting on water insecurity this past Monday, in Jordan, reports the Jordan Times. They recognized climate change in the Middle East as an issue that will further impact their poorly-available water resources, noting that 75% of the surface water in the Arab world, originates from outside its borders.
Reporters were given a sneak peak at Burj Khalifa at 828m tall, this week. The world’s tallest building, could attract international investment to the debt-afflicted emirate.
Dubai inaugurated Burj Dubai (now Burj Khalifa after Sheikh Khalifa bin Zayed, President of the UAE), the world’s tallest building, with a spectacular display of sound, light, water and fireworks on Monday. Burj Dubai, a development of Emaar properties, stands at more than 800 meters (2,625 ft) high with 160 storeys, making it the tallest man-made structure ever built.
“This is not just a building that’s a little bit bigger than other buildings. It’s much bigger,” Christian Koch, Director of International Studies at the Gulf Research Center in Dubai told The Media Line. “Everybody will know about it. This is certainly going to represent the status of Dubai and the Arab Gulf as a whole for many years.”
